What's the difference between hemp and cannabis

The distinction between Hemp and Marijuana
Exactly what is the difference between Hemp and Marijuana?
An Over-all overview:

The Slice to chase answer is: the primary difference is in its use. The two are relevant from the exact same species of plant, both are kinds of the plant Cannabis Sativa L. They can be effectively weeds that may mature in numerous types of ailments, climates, and soil varieties. Through the years equally crops are useful for lots of utilizes. Nonetheless, they are not the same.

When industrial-grade hemp is actually a relatively valuable source on the earth, it lacks the stimulating electric power from the substance known as delta-9 tetrahydrocannabinol, or for short, THC. It Is that this active chemical of THC that delivers regarding the “superior” associated with marijuana. The phrase ‘Hemp‘ typically refers to the industrial/commercial use on the cannabis stalk and seed for textiles, foods, papers, body treatment goods, detergents, plastics and setting up components. The time period ‘cannabis’ refers to the medicinal, recreational or spiritual use involving the smoking of cannabis bouquets.

In line with US regulation, hemp would be the stalks, stems and sterilized seeds of cannabis sativa, and marijuana would be the leaves, bouquets and feasible seeds of cannabis sativa. Male or female cannabis has no differentiation by regulation or science, further than sexual intercourse.

The amount of THC Does Hemp Have?

Mainly because of the way hemp is developed and its separation from marijuana, hemp has a Substantially decreased THC written content. Industrial hemp consists of only about 0.01% – one.five% THC (Tetrahydrocannabinoids, the intoxicating ingredients that make you higher) although cannabis is made up of about five% – 10% or even more THC. The small volume of THC is what would make hemp worthless for finding high. It has been approximated by some researchers of hemp that it could take an acre of hemp to get significant. In one acre of hemp There may be about ten-twenty a lot of plant content developed. Think of that.

Compared to cannabis sativa indica, cannabis sativa sativa (industrial hemp wide range) incorporates a Considerably much better fiber. This fiber can be utilized in something from rope and blankets to paper. Marijuana fiber contains a lower tensile strength and can split or shred easily, which makes it a lousy fibrous plant in comparison to industrial hemp.

Industrial hemp also grows in a different way than THC-that contains cannabis ( Marijuana). Hemp is typically grown up, not out, because the emphasis is not really on creating buds but on manufacturing duration of stalk. In this way, hemp is an extremely very similar crop to bamboo. The stalk has the fiber and tough, woody Main materials that may be useful for a number of purposes, even carpentry. Generally, THC-manufacturing marijuana crops are developed to a mean of 5 ft in peak. Industrial hemp On the flip side is developed to some height of 10 to fifteen ft prior to harvest. The two also vary from the parts that they are often successfully developed. THC-manufacturing Cannabis must be grown in frequently warm and humid environments in order to develop the desired quantity and quality of THC-containing buds. Nevertheless, since industrial hemp does not contain these buds, plus the hardy parts of the plant are the greater preferred, it may be grown in a very wider choice of locations. Learn More Normally, industrial hemp grows most effective on fields that offer significant yields for corn crops, which includes most of the Southwest, Southeast, and Northeast U.s..
